Breaking Down the Kinetic Chain Components
The golf swing relies on a sequence of movements called the kinetic chain, where energy is built and transferred through three main segments. Each part plays a unique role in powering your swing, and understanding these elements can help maximize your performance.
Lower Body: Feet, Legs, and Hips
Your swing starts with your feet, which provide a stable base and push against the ground to generate force. This force travels up through your legs, creating the foundation for rotation.
The hips are the driving force, initiating the rotation that transfers energy from the lower body to the upper body. To achieve this, your hips should begin rotating toward the target before your shoulders – a concept known as proximal-to-distal sequencing. This sequence allows your hips to store elastic energy, which is crucial for an efficient swing. If your hips and shoulders move together, this energy is lost, reducing the power of your swing. For right-handed golfers, additional force is applied to the front of the right foot and the back of the left foot, further fueling the chain.
This lower-body action sets the stage for the upper body to build on and direct the energy.
Core and Upper Body: Torso and Shoulders
Once the lower body initiates the motion, the torso and shoulders take over, amplifying the energy. Your core – especially the obliques and abdominal muscles – plays a key role as the torso unwinds, adding speed to the rotation. This energy is then passed to the shoulders, which ensure a smooth transition to the next phase. Timing is critical here: the torso should lead, followed by the shoulders, to maintain the flow of power through the chain.
Arms and Club: The Final Link
The arms and club form the last part of the kinetic chain, acting as levers to transfer energy to the ball. A crucial component at this stage is maintaining lag – the angle between your lead arm and the club shaft during the downswing. This lag stores energy like a compressed spring, which is released just before impact. Releasing your wrists too early (a mistake known as casting) wastes this stored energy. At the moment of impact, your wrists unhinge, and your arms extend fully, creating a whip-like motion that accelerates the clubhead.
Even with a perfectly executed kinetic chain, striking the ball in the center of the clubface is essential. Proper contact ensures that the energy from the clubhead translates into maximum ball speed and distance. Without it, much of the power generated through the chain can go to waste.
Common Mistakes That Break the Kinetic Chain
Certain mistakes can throw off the energy transfer in your golf swing, cutting into your distance and making your movements feel disconnected. Often, these errors happen without you even noticing, transforming what should be a smooth, powerful motion into a series of inefficient actions. Let’s dive into the most common issues that disrupt this essential flow of energy.
Poor Movement Timing
One of the biggest errors golfers make is starting the downswing with their upper body instead of their lower body.
When your hips and shoulders rotate simultaneously instead of in a proper sequence, you disrupt the chain reaction – often called the "domino effect" – that generates power. This forces you to rely on your arms for strength, which not only reduces distance but also makes your swing less consistent. Starting with your arms interrupts the wave-like energy transfer, which should culminate in a powerful snap at impact.
Top golfers, on the other hand, begin the downswing with their lower body. The movement then flows through the torso, arms, and finally the club, ensuring maximum energy transfer. Breaking this sequence creates "energy leaks" throughout your swing. Even players with unconventional swings, like Jim Furyk, stick to this critical order, while amateurs often lose it by engaging their upper body too early.
This misstep has real consequences. Breaking the kinematic sequence can reduce clubhead speed by up to 20%, which could mean losing 20-40 yards off your drives. Physical limitations, such as stiffness or weakness, can make maintaining this sequence even harder.
Limited Flexibility and Strength
If you lack mobility in key areas like your hips, core, or shoulders, it can disrupt energy transfer. This forces your body to compensate in inefficient ways, reducing swing power and increasing your risk of injury.
Restricted hip mobility is particularly troublesome. When your hips can’t rotate properly, your upper body or arms often end up overcompensating to generate power. Unfortunately, these adjustments don’t work well – they slow down your swing and make consistent ball-striking nearly impossible.
Beyond hurting performance, these limitations put extra strain on smaller stabilizing muscles that aren’t built to handle the primary workload. Over time, this can lead to ingrained swing flaws and a heightened risk of injury. Addressing these physical issues can unlock a more efficient and powerful swing.
Overusing Arms Instead of Full Body
Many golfers make the mistake of trying to "muscle" the ball with their arms instead of letting their entire body work together to build speed from the ground up. This arm-dominant approach bypasses the stronger muscles in your legs and core, leading to a significant loss of clubhead speed and driving distance.
Your arms and wrists simply aren’t built to generate the main force in your swing. When you rely on them too much, you’re asking some of the smallest muscles in your body to do a job meant for the largest ones. This not only wastes potential power but also tires you out faster.
The difference is clear. Golfers who properly engage their whole body through effective kinetic chain sequencing can gain 30-50 yards off the tee. Some have even added as much as 60 yards simply by learning to use their legs, core, and torso instead of just their arms.
An arm-heavy swing also leads to inconsistency. Without the solid foundation that comes from proper lower-body initiation, your swing becomes harder to repeat. While you might occasionally hit a great shot when everything lines up, it’s not something you can rely on. Correcting this habit can make your swing more efficient and your results far more predictable.

How to Improve Your Kinetic Chain for Maximum Power
Now that you know what disrupts the kinetic chain, it’s time to focus on rebuilding it. Strengthening your kinetic chain isn’t just about driving the ball farther – it’s about developing a swing that’s efficient, consistent, and less likely to cause injury. By working on your strength, mobility, and technique, you can tap into serious power potential.
Building Strength and Mobility
Strength and flexibility are the backbone of a powerful swing. When each part of your body is strong and flexible, energy flows efficiently from the ground up, creating a solid foundation for your swing.
Let’s start with the lower body – your swing’s main source of power. Exercises like squats, lunges, deadlifts, and jump drills mimic the loading and unloading motions of a golf swing. These movements train your muscles to generate force from the ground and transfer it upward effectively.
Your core is the bridge between your lower and upper body, playing a huge role in generating force. To strengthen this area, try planks for stability and rotational exercises like Russian twists or medicine ball throws. These moves improve your ability to transfer energy without losing it through weak stabilizing muscles.
Mobility is just as important as strength. Stretching your hip flexors, hamstrings, and torso ensures that your body moves as it should during your swing. Free hip rotation and a flexible spine allow energy to flow smoothly through the kinetic chain. Regular stretching also helps prevent compensatory movements that can sap power.
Research shows that improving your kinematic sequence can add 10–20 yards to your drives on average. Some golfers have even reported gains of 20–30 yards just by fine-tuning their kinetic chain.
Practicing Proper Movement Order
Once you’ve built your strength and mobility, it’s time to focus on the sequence of movements. Elite golfers generate power by starting their swing from the lower body, then transitioning to the torso, arms, and finally the club. This precise order ensures that energy transfers efficiently, maximizing speed at impact.
To train this sequence, begin with slow-motion swings to feel the proper order of movements. Gradually increase your speed while maintaining the correct sequence. On your downswing, push off your back foot and rotate your hips first, keeping your upper body quiet. Let your torso follow, then your arms, and finally the club. This lag creates maximum clubhead speed where it matters most – at impact.
Practicing without a ball can help you focus solely on the movement. Many golfers find it easier to feel the correct sequence when they’re not worried about making contact. Using video analysis is another great tool – recording your swing from different angles can reveal whether you’re sticking to the proper sequence or slipping back into bad habits.

Practical Drills to Master the Kinetic Chain
Practice drills are key to building the muscle memory needed for a smooth and powerful swing. Below are three drills designed to help you feel the correct sequence of movements and reinforce the essential elements of the kinetic chain. By focusing on specific aspects – from harnessing ground-up power to perfecting the release at impact – you’ll refine your swing and improve efficiency.
Ground-Up Power Drill
This drill emphasizes generating power from the ground while maintaining the correct swing sequence. The goal is to feel how energy flows from your feet, through your body, and into the clubhead.
Begin in your normal address position with your weight evenly distributed. As you start your backswing, shift your weight to your trail leg while keeping your posture intact. The focus here is on feeling the push from the ground as you transition into the downswing.
Initiate the downswing by driving off your back foot and rotating your hips toward the target. Let your hips, torso, and arms naturally follow in sequence. Practice slow swings to reinforce this flow: push with your feet, turn your hips, uncoil your torso, and let your arms follow. Many golfers are surprised at how much power they can generate when they stop relying on their arms and let their body lead the motion.
Medicine Ball Rotational Throws
Medicine ball throws are excellent for developing rotational power and core strength – both critical components of an efficient kinetic chain.
Stand in a stance similar to your golf posture, holding a medicine ball at chest height. Rotate your body as if performing a backswing, focusing on initiating the movement from your lower body. Push off your back foot and rotate your hips toward the target. As your hips lead, allow your core to unwind and your arms to release the ball as the final link in the chain.
This drill reinforces the idea that power starts in the legs, with the core playing a key role in transferring that energy through to your upper body and arms.
Lag and Release Drill
The Lag and Release Drill focuses on maintaining the critical angle – known as lag – between your lead arm and the club shaft. This angle stores energy that is released at impact for maximum power.
Begin with practice swings, paying attention to keeping your wrists hinged as your body starts to unwind during the downswing. The goal is to hold this lag as your body segments accelerate in sequence. Think of your arms and wrists as a lever system, holding the stored energy until just before impact. At that moment, your wrists unhinge, and your arms extend fully.
Avoid the common mistake of releasing your wrists too early, known as casting, as it diminishes stored energy and reduces power. Start with slow, deliberate swings and gradually increase your speed. With practice, the explosive release will feel natural, adding both power and consistency to your swing on the course.

FAQs
How can I tell if my golf swing is disrupting the kinetic chain, and what quick fixes can I try?
The kinetic chain plays a crucial role in your golf swing, ensuring energy flows seamlessly from your lower body to your upper body. If you’re noticing inconsistent ball striking, a drop in power, or a sense of being out of sync during your swing, it could mean this chain is being disrupted.
To address this, start by focusing on balance and proper sequencing. A solid foundation is key – check your foot positioning and make sure you’re transferring weight correctly. Drills like slow-motion swings can help you fine-tune the sequence of movements: hips first, followed by the torso, then the arms, and finally the club. With consistent practice, you can rebuild that smooth energy transfer, leading to more powerful and accurate swings.
What are some effective exercises to improve flexibility and strength for a better golf swing?
Improving your golf swing starts with boosting flexibility and strength to fine-tune your kinetic chain. To get there, prioritize exercises that build core stability, hip mobility, and rotational strength. Some excellent choices include planks, rotational lunges, and medicine ball twists – these target your core and help transfer energy more effectively during your swing.
For flexibility, focus on stretches like hip flexor stretches, spinal twists, and hamstring stretches. These will help expand your range of motion, making your swing smoother and more controlled.
Commit to these exercises regularly, and you’ll notice a more efficient swing, improved driving distance, and better overall performance on the course.
Why is it important to follow the correct sequence in the kinetic chain, and how does it affect my golf swing and performance?
The kinetic chain refers to how energy moves through your body during a swing, starting at your feet and flowing all the way to your hands. When the sequence is followed correctly, energy transfers smoothly from your lower body to your upper body, resulting in a stronger and more accurate swing.
If the sequence is disrupted, energy can be lost, leading to weaker shots and inconsistent results. By refining this flow, you can not only boost your driving distance but also gain better control and precision on the course.
